June 22, 2010 Community Advisory Group Meeting, Cheyenne Wyoming
The Community Advisory Group (CAG) met to listen to a presentation on a potential innovative technology that could potentially be deployed in the source area at the Missile Site. 

November 16, 2010 – US Army Corps of Engineers to host a public meeting on the status of the site and the process for forming a Restoration Advisory Board. Laramie County Library, 2200 Pioneer Avenue, Cottonwood Room from 5:30-7:30pm

June 7, 2011 - First Restoration Advisory Board Meeting held by the US Army Corps of Engineers.  The Board met to hear a presentation on work to date at the site and up-coming plans.  The meeting was open to the public.
